Wine is the answer!

Well perhaps not the wine itself but the gas bottles you can buy to preserve opened bottles of wine.
I buy "Private Preserve" from the Napa Valley. It contains pressurized nitrogen, carbon dioxide and argon in a bottle about 10" tall that feels as though its empty even when new and costs about $10.
There are probably cheaper options but that is available at the local wine store.
It does a great job preserving wine and I'd imagine it would be just as good at protecting a stylus suspension from oxygen in the air.
